The ‘Verse! Podcast #9 – A Mysterious Voice, WandaVision Eps 5 & 6, Loki and Chaos

It’s that time of the week to step into The ‘Verse! – the podcast where we visit different corners of the cinematic universes from Marvel, Star Wars, DC, and beyond. 

This week we dive into WandaVision episodes 5 & 6. Even if you watched before you will enjoy and maybe learn something from our episode breakdowns. We also check out the latest trending hashtags on what cinematic universe should be restored next (this week it seems to be about Schumacher Batman FYI), check-in on Ewan McGregor’s Obi-Wan beard progress and other amusing topics.

Hello WandaVision? Yeah, the 80s called and they want their hairstyles back! Well maybe except for Vision’s… yeah Vision’s can definitely stay. That’s right! The decade you thought was completely erased from everyone’s memories is now Westview’s new reality and to make things even worse, somehow this picture-perfect reality is starting to fall apart. Norm blames it all on the mullets. But don’t worry because we quickly pass through the 80s at a supersonic speed thanks to a helpful guest appearance by Westfield’s version of Uncle Jesse(?) and BOOM! Just like that, we’re in the 2000s. ‘Verselings, you’re going to have to let us know what shows you watched as a child on Nick At Nite because the ‘Verse Squad seems to be experiencing a, how should you say it, generational gap surrounding nostalgic sitcoms. 

News like the most recent trailer and poster for Loki are discussed too. Can we expect some Doctor Who vibes from the series? And even the latest sneak preview of Black Widow. Oh, and apparently Tom Hiddleston and Chris Hemsworth have a bigger bromance than our own Norm and Lucas as the duo celebrated 10 years of being MCU’s God of Mischief and Thunder.
